Essential Tips for Healthy Eyes in the Digital Age

 

  

In today’s digital
age, we spend an increasing amount of time using screens, whether it’s for
work, school, or leisure. This increased screen time can put a strain on our
eyes, leading to symptoms such as eye fatigue, dry eyes, and blurred vision.

The Impact of PC and
Mobile Use on Eye Health

•          Eye Strain: Prolonged screen use can
cause the muscles in your eyes to fatigue, leading to symptoms such as blurred
vision, headaches, and difficulty focusing.

•          Dry Eyes: When you’re focused on a
screen, you tend to blink less often, which can dry out your eyes. This can
lead to discomfort, redness, and itchiness.

•          Digital Eye Syndrome: This condition
is a collection of symptoms that can occur from prolonged screen use, including
eye strain, dry eyes, headaches, and blurred vision.

Protecting Your Eyes
from PC and Mobile Use

•          Take regular breaks: It’s important to
give your eyes a break from screens every 20 minutes. Look away from the screen
for at least 20 seconds and focus on something in the distance.

•          Blink often: Blinking helps to keep
your eyes moist and prevent them from drying out. Aim to blink at least 20
times per minute.

•          Adjust your screen brightness: Make
sure your screen brightness is not too bright or too dark. The ideal brightness
level is one that is comfortable for you to look at without straining your
eyes.

•          Use the 20-20-20 rule: Every 20
minutes, look away from your screen at something that is 20 feet away for 20
seconds. This will help to relax your eyes and refocus them.

•          Position your screen correctly: Your
screen should be positioned directly in front of you and slightly below eye
level. This will help to prevent you from having to strain your neck to look at
the screen.

By following these
tips, you can help to protect your eyes from the strain of PC and mobile use
and keep your vision healthy for years to come.
